for those who want a fade that is more than 10 percent you can edit the source.
in the BasicTransparent.m file change the .1 to .whatever in the lines:
if ([win alphaValue]!=0.1)
[win setAlphaValue:0.1];
i know this is not practical for most, but it took me all of 30 seconds to edit, compile and install, and this is before i figured out what to edit.
